Ordinals
beta
Sat 931955877786224
decimal
186391.877786224
degree
0°186391′919″877786224‴
percentile
44.37885137197028%
name
hgcifqmacjx
cycle
0
epoch
0
period
92
block
186391
offset
877786224
timestamp
2012-06-27 00:17:21 UTC
rarity
common
prev
next